Mesothelioma Asbestos Law Firms
Asbestos victims affected by m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ases should contact a national law firm. These firms have the expertise and resources to handle asbestos cases across the country.
They are knowledgeable about asbestos litigation and how to file lawsuits and trust fund claims. In addition, these lawyers can travel to meet with clients, if needed.
Lawyers with experience
Lawyers from asbestos law firms with experience in mesothelioma have dealt with compensation claims for asbestos-related diseases. They have helped victims, and their families, receive significant awards. These funds are used to pay for medical expenses, end-of-life expenses, travel costs, and accommodation.
It is important to verify their experience and knowledge before selecting an asbestos lawyer to ensure that they are the best fit for your situation. You should also inquire about how many mesothelioma lawsuits the firm has handled and what their success rates were.
A professional mesothelioma lawyer with a good reputation will have access to databases that record details about businesses which exposed workers to asbestos, as well as workers who handled those asbestos-containing products. This information can be used to identify potential defendants and help you create a solid legal strategy.
Asbestos lawyers understand the complex legal procedures and can assist you in completing all the paperwork required for filing an asbestos suit or submitting an application to a mesothelioma foundation. They can also help you to determine the right jurisdiction for your case, and file it within the deadlines set by law.
A mesothelioma lawyer that focuses on veterans' claims will assist you in obtaining benefits from the VA if you are a veteran. These lawyers are well-versed in the specific asbestos-related diseases that affect service members and different military branches.
Mesothelioma, a rare form of cancer, attacks the lung linings (pleural mesothelioma) and the abdominal region (peritoneal mesothelioma peritoneal) or the heart (pericardial mesothelioma of the pericardium). An expert asbestos lawyer can assist you fight for justice by fighting for the full amount of compensation needed to pay for medical bills, lost wages and other damages.
Asbestos lawyers can make the litigation process more manageable by helping to prepare evidence, coordinate depositions and answer questions from defendants' lawyers. They can also spot mistakes in procedure, stop the defendants from receiving information they're not entitled see and provide you with an honest assessment of the merits of your case. They can also assist you to determine the ideal kind of settlement for your goals and needs. If you and your lawyer cannot reach a consensus on a settlement, they can go to trial.

Contingency Fees
The top asbestos-related law firms in mesothelioma will work on a contingency basis, meaning you pay no upfront fees or contract fees to have a lawyer representing you. Instead, lawyers are paid from the settlement or judgment that you receive. They will not take on a case unless they are certain that they will win compensation.
National mesothelioma lawyers will be familiarized with the laws of each state, including the statutes of limitations and they will be aware of which court is the most likely to be successful in your case. Many asbestos-related firms have offices in New York, and they can travel to you in the event of need. They also know local medical and forensic experts.
These lawyers have a wealth of experience in representing families and victims in complicated litigation. They have the resources necessary to gather evidence and give you the most effective representation. Mesothelioma lawyers will have access databases and expert witnesses. They will document your case, investigate and take depositions, argue on your behalf before jurors and negotiate the settlement.
A skilled attorney can determine the responsible companies for your exposure. They will also be able to determine whether your incident occurred at multiple locations. If it does you could be able to start a multidistrict litigation lawsuit (MDL).
The manufacturers could have averted asbestos exposure if they'd made it clear about the dangers. They hid these dangers for years, putting people like you at a high risk of developing asbestos-related illnesses.
Your family and you could be entitled to substantial compensation if you file a wrongful death claim. These claims are filed on behalf of the families of those who lost a loved one to asbestosis, mesothelioma or any other asbestos-related diseases.
Mesothelioma lawsuits can be complicated. Asbestos defendants are often located in different states and the asbestos manufacturing process might have taken place in a variety of locations. Asbestos victims who were exposed to these companies could be in different states, and it's crucial for your attorney to be aware of the laws of each state. operate.
Free Case Evaluation
If you have been diagnosed with mesothelioma an experienced lawyer can help you to file a claim. A good law firm will take care of the entire cost of your case, such as filing fees, medical records and more. These costs will be subtracted from your final compensation payout.
Mesothelioma lawyers will collect and analyze evidence to support your case. This may include your asbestos exposure history, mesothelioma diagnosis and any other pertinent documents or evidence. thousand oaks mesothelioma lawyer will also hire mesothelioma experts, such as industrial hygienists and doctors and other experts to aid in your case. They can explain how mesothelioma has impacted you and the reasons behind it.
Lawyers can also conduct an in-depth analysis to identify potential asbestos exposure sources. It isn't always easy to pinpoint the source of exposure to asbestos due to mesothelioma's latency period. The disease may have started decades after you were exposed. An attorney can examine the background of your client, identify other asbestos victims, asbestos companies, and join a network to help with their case.
A good asbestos mesothelioma law firm will also handle your legal issues and ensure that all defendants have the opportunity to respond. They also handle the production of proof, schedule and conduct depositions and file motions. They will also provide guidance on the best time to accept the settlement offer or go to litigation.
An asbestos attorney for mesothelioma can assist you in obtaining compensation from trusts set for the purpose of paying victims of asbestos-related diseases. A successful claim could provide you and your family members with compensation to cover your medical expenses, funeral costs as well as loss of income and much more.
